gown; elegant dress
Refers to a formal or elegant gown, such as an evening gown or academic robe. Not used for everyday clothing.
She stood on the stage wearing a white gown.
The students wore black gowns at the graduation ceremony.
dressing gown; bathrobe
Commonly used for a bathrobe or a comfortable robe worn at home, especially after bathing or while relaxing.
I put on a bathrobe after taking a bath.
After the bath, I slipped on a robe and relaxed.
He was drinking coffee dressed in his robe.
As soon as the ceremony ended, she took off her gown.
白衣 specifically means the white coat worn by doctors or scientists, while ガウン is a looser term for any long robe-like garment, including bathrobes or ceremonial gowns.
